.pricing-page-module__XIdHSa__pageShell{background:var(--white)}.pricing-page-module__XIdHSa__page{background:radial-gradient(circle at 0 0,#d98a2b1f,#0000 32%),linear-gradient(#f8fafc 0%,#eef3f9 100%);min-height:100vh}.pricing-page-module__XIdHSa__hero{padding:calc(76px + 3rem) 0 2.5rem}.pricing-page-module__XIdHSa__heroShell{-webkit-backdrop-filter:blur(10px);background:#ffffffe6;border:1px solid #0f274414;border-radius:32px;grid-template-columns:minmax(0,1.2fr) minmax(320px,.85fr);gap:1.5rem;padding:1.9rem;display:grid;box-shadow:0 28px 80px #0f274414}.pricing-page-module__XIdHSa__heroCopy{padding:.4rem .2rem .2rem}.pricing-page-module__XIdHSa__title{letter-spacing:-.02em;color:var(--navy);margin:0 0 1rem;font-family:Cormorant Garamond,serif;font-size:clamp(2.7rem,5vw,4.5rem);font-weight:600;line-height:.98}.pricing-page-module__XIdHSa__heroActions{flex-wrap:wrap;align-items:center;gap:.85rem;margin-top:1.6rem;display:flex}.pricing-page-module__XIdHSa__heroAside{color:#fff;background:linear-gradient(#0f2744,#143358f5);border-radius:28px;flex-direction:column;gap:1rem;padding:1.7rem;display:flex;box-shadow:0 28px 70px #0f27442e}.pricing-page-module__XIdHSa__activeEyebrow{letter-spacing:.18em;text-transform:uppercase;color:#ffffff8f;font-size:.76rem;font-weight:600}.pricing-page-module__XIdHSa__activeTitle{margin:0;font-family:Cormorant Garamond,serif;font-size:2.15rem;font-weight:600;line-height:1.02}.pricing-page-module__XIdHSa__activeSummary{color:#ffffffbd;font-size:.97rem;line-height:1.72}.pricing-page-module__XIdHSa__activeMeta{color:#ffffffad;border-top:1px solid #ffffff1a;padding-top:.95rem;font-size:.84rem;font-weight:500}.pricing-page-module__XIdHSa__highlightList{grid-template-columns:repeat(2,minmax(0,1fr));gap:.7rem;display:grid}.pricing-page-module__XIdHSa__highlightItem{color:#ffffffe0;background:#ffffff14;border:1px solid #ffffff14;border-radius:16px;padding:.78rem .9rem;font-size:.82rem;line-height:1.45}.pricing-page-module__XIdHSa__featuredBlock{background:#d98a2b29;border:1px solid #d98a2b3d;border-radius:18px;margin-top:auto;padding:1rem 1.1rem}.pricing-page-module__XIdHSa__featuredValue{color:var(--copper-pale);font-family:Cormorant Garamond,serif;font-size:2rem;font-weight:700;line-height:1.04}.pricing-page-module__XIdHSa__featuredLabel{color:#ffffffb3;margin-top:.35rem;font-size:.84rem;line-height:1.55}.pricing-page-module__XIdHSa__contentSection{padding:0 0 4rem}.pricing-page-module__XIdHSa__tabsShell{z-index:1;background:linear-gradient(#fffffffa,#f4f7fbf5);border:1px solid #0f274414;border-radius:16px;width:100%;margin:-1.1rem auto 1.35rem;padding:.16rem;transition:transform .24s,opacity .22s;position:relative;overflow:hidden;box-shadow:0 12px 28px #0f274414}.pricing-page-module__XIdHSa__tabsShellNav{box-shadow:none;background:0 0;border:none;border-radius:0;margin:0;padding:0;overflow:visible}.pricing-page-module__XIdHSa__tabs{width:100%;box-shadow:none;background:0 0;border:none;border-radius:0;grid-template-columns:repeat(8,minmax(0,1fr));align-items:stretch;gap:.08rem;padding:0;display:grid;overflow:hidden}.pricing-page-module__XIdHSa__tabsNav{gap:.08rem}.pricing-page-module__XIdHSa__tabs::-webkit-scrollbar{display:none}.pricing-page-module__XIdHSa__tabButton{width:100%;min-width:0;min-height:40px;color:var(--gray-600);white-space:nowrap;transition:var(--transition);background:0 0;border:1px solid #0000;border-radius:999px;justify-content:center;align-items:center;padding:.46rem .28rem;display:inline-flex}.pricing-page-module__XIdHSa__tabButtonNav{background:#ffffffeb;min-height:34px;padding:.34rem .24rem}.pricing-page-module__XIdHSa__tabButton:hover,.pricing-page-module__XIdHSa__tabButton:focus-visible{color:var(--navy);background:linear-gradient(#fffffffa,#f6f8fbfa);border-color:#0f274414;box-shadow:inset 0 -2px #0f274414}.pricing-page-module__XIdHSa__tabButtonActive{box-shadow:inset 0 -2px 0 var(--copper),0 8px 18px #0f274414;color:var(--navy);background:linear-gradient(#fff,#f8fafcfa);border-color:#d98a2b33}.pricing-page-module__XIdHSa__tabButtonActive:hover,.pricing-page-module__XIdHSa__tabButtonActive:focus-visible{box-shadow:inset 0 -2px 0 var(--copper),0 8px 18px #0f274414;color:var(--navy);background:linear-gradient(#fff,#f8fafcfa);border-color:#d98a2b3d}.pricing-page-module__XIdHSa__tabTop{justify-content:center;align-items:center;gap:.24rem;min-width:0;display:inline-flex}.pricing-page-module__XIdHSa__tabTopNav{gap:.18rem}.pricing-page-module__XIdHSa__tabIcon{stroke-linecap:round;stroke-linejoin:round;flex-shrink:0;width:.88rem;height:.88rem}.pricing-page-module__XIdHSa__tabIconNav{width:.78rem;height:.78rem}.pricing-page-module__XIdHSa__tabLabel{text-align:center;font-size:.75rem;font-weight:600;line-height:1.05}.pricing-page-module__XIdHSa__tabLabelNav{font-size:.68rem}.pricing-page-module__XIdHSa__panel{background:#fff;border:1px solid #0f274414;border-radius:30px;padding:2rem;scroll-margin-top:calc(76px + 5.5rem);box-shadow:0 24px 80px #0f274414}.pricing-page-module__XIdHSa__panelHeader{flex-wrap:wrap;justify-content:space-between;align-items:flex-start;gap:1.5rem;display:flex}.pricing-page-module__XIdHSa__panelHeaderMain{max-width:760px}.pricing-page-module__XIdHSa__panelEyebrow{letter-spacing:.16em;text-transform:uppercase;color:var(--copper);font-size:.78rem;font-weight:700}.pricing-page-module__XIdHSa__panelTitle{color:var(--navy);margin:.5rem 0 0;font-family:Cormorant Garamond,serif;font-size:clamp(2rem,4vw,3rem);font-weight:600;line-height:1.04}.pricing-page-module__XIdHSa__panelSummary{max-width:60ch;color:var(--gray-600);margin:.9rem 0 0;font-size:1rem;line-height:1.75}.pricing-page-module__XIdHSa__panelMeta{color:var(--gray-400);margin-top:.85rem;font-size:.86rem;font-weight:600}.pricing-page-module__XIdHSa__overviewActions{flex-wrap:wrap;gap:.7rem;display:flex}.pricing-page-module__XIdHSa__inlineAction,.pricing-page-module__XIdHSa__inlineActionSecondary{border-radius:14px;justify-content:center;align-items:center;padding:.85rem 1rem;font-size:.88rem;font-weight:600;display:inline-flex}.pricing-page-module__XIdHSa__inlineAction{color:var(--navy);background:#d98a2b1f;border:1px solid #d98a2b2e}.pricing-page-module__XIdHSa__inlineActionSecondary{color:var(--navy);background:#0f27440d;border:1px solid #0f274414}.pricing-page-module__XIdHSa__noteBox{color:var(--gray-800);background:#d98a2b14;border:1px solid #d98a2b29;border-radius:18px;margin-top:1.35rem;padding:1rem 1.15rem;font-size:.92rem;line-height:1.7}.pricing-page-module__XIdHSa__sections{flex-direction:column;gap:1.1rem;margin-top:1.6rem;display:flex}.pricing-page-module__XIdHSa__sectionCard{background:linear-gradient(#fbfcfe,#f6f8fb);border:1px solid #0f27440f;border-radius:24px;padding:1.45rem}.pricing-page-module__XIdHSa__sectionHeader{flex-wrap:wrap;justify-content:space-between;align-items:flex-start;gap:1rem;margin-bottom:1rem;display:flex}.pricing-page-module__XIdHSa__sectionKicker{letter-spacing:.16em;text-transform:uppercase;color:var(--copper);font-size:.72rem;font-weight:700}.pricing-page-module__XIdHSa__sectionTitle{color:var(--navy);margin:.35rem 0 0;font-family:Cormorant Garamond,serif;font-size:1.65rem;font-weight:600}.pricing-page-module__XIdHSa__sectionDescription{max-width:40ch;color:var(--gray-600);font-size:.9rem;line-height:1.65}.pricing-page-module__XIdHSa__tableWrap{background:#fff;border:1px solid #0f274412;border-radius:20px;overflow:hidden}.pricing-page-module__XIdHSa__pricingTable{border-collapse:collapse;width:100%}.pricing-page-module__XIdHSa__pricingTable thead th{color:var(--gray-600);letter-spacing:.12em;text-transform:uppercase;text-align:right;background:#0f274408;border-bottom:1px solid #0f274414;padding:.95rem 1rem;font-size:.74rem;font-weight:700}.pricing-page-module__XIdHSa__pricingTable thead th:first-child{text-align:left}.pricing-page-module__XIdHSa__pricingTable tbody th,.pricing-page-module__XIdHSa__pricingTable tbody td{vertical-align:top;border-top:1px solid #0f27440f;padding:1rem}.pricing-page-module__XIdHSa__pricingTable tbody tr:first-child th,.pricing-page-module__XIdHSa__pricingTable tbody tr:first-child td{border-top:none}.pricing-page-module__XIdHSa__pricingTable tbody tr:nth-child(2n){background:#0f274404}.pricing-page-module__XIdHSa__pricingTable tbody td{color:var(--navy);text-align:right;white-space:nowrap;font-size:.92rem;font-weight:500}.pricing-page-module__XIdHSa__serviceCell{text-align:left;width:40%}.pricing-page-module__XIdHSa__serviceName{color:var(--navy);font-size:.97rem;font-weight:600;line-height:1.5;display:block}.pricing-page-module__XIdHSa__serviceDescription{color:var(--gray-600);margin-top:.35rem;font-size:.84rem;font-weight:400;line-height:1.55;display:block}.pricing-page-module__XIdHSa__bottomCta{padding:0 0 4rem}.pricing-page-module__XIdHSa__bottomCtaCard{color:#fff;background:linear-gradient(135deg,#0f2744,#163660f5);border-radius:28px;justify-content:space-between;align-items:center;gap:1.5rem;padding:2rem 2.2rem;display:flex;box-shadow:0 24px 70px #0f274429}.pricing-page-module__XIdHSa__bottomCtaEyebrow{letter-spacing:.18em;text-transform:uppercase;color:#ffffff8c;font-size:.78rem;font-weight:700}.pricing-page-module__XIdHSa__bottomCtaTitle{margin:.55rem 0 0;font-family:Cormorant Garamond,serif;font-size:clamp(2rem,4vw,2.8rem);font-weight:600;line-height:1.05}.pricing-page-module__XIdHSa__bottomCtaText{color:#ffffffbd;max-width:54ch;margin-top:.8rem;font-size:.98rem;line-height:1.75}.pricing-page-module__XIdHSa__bottomCtaActions{flex-wrap:wrap;gap:.85rem;display:flex}.pricing-page-module__XIdHSa__bottomActionButton{border-radius:15px;justify-content:center;min-height:48px;padding:.82rem 1.18rem;font-size:.9rem}.pricing-page-module__XIdHSa__bottomActionButtonSecondary{color:#fff;background:#ffffff14;border-color:#ffffff38}.pricing-page-module__XIdHSa__bottomActionButtonSecondary:hover{color:#fff;background:#ffffff29;border-color:#ffffff52}@media (max-width:1100px){.pricing-page-module__XIdHSa__heroShell{grid-template-columns:1fr}.pricing-page-module__XIdHSa__highlightList{grid-template-columns:repeat(4,minmax(0,1fr))}}@media (max-width:1024px){.pricing-page-module__XIdHSa__tabsShell{z-index:30;position:sticky;top:calc(76px + .65rem)}.pricing-page-module__XIdHSa__tabsShellNav{display:none}.pricing-page-module__XIdHSa__tabs{scrollbar-width:none;scroll-snap-type:x proximity;overscroll-behavior-x:contain;flex-wrap:nowrap;justify-content:flex-start;align-items:flex-end;gap:.14rem;padding:0;display:flex;overflow:auto hidden}.pricing-page-module__XIdHSa__tabButton{scroll-snap-align:center;flex:none;width:auto;min-height:42px;padding:.5rem .76rem}.pricing-page-module__XIdHSa__tabTop{justify-content:flex-start}}@media (max-width:900px){.pricing-page-module__XIdHSa__panelHeader,.pricing-page-module__XIdHSa__bottomCtaCard{flex-direction:column;align-items:flex-start}}@media (max-width:768px){.pricing-page-module__XIdHSa__hero{padding:calc(76px + 2rem) 0 2rem}.pricing-page-module__XIdHSa__heroShell,.pricing-page-module__XIdHSa__panel,.pricing-page-module__XIdHSa__bottomCtaCard{border-radius:24px;padding:1.35rem}.pricing-page-module__XIdHSa__highlightList{grid-template-columns:1fr 1fr}.pricing-page-module__XIdHSa__tabsShell{border-radius:12px;margin:-.8rem auto 1rem;padding:.12rem;top:calc(76px + .55rem)}.pricing-page-module__XIdHSa__tabs{gap:.12rem}.pricing-page-module__XIdHSa__tabButton{min-height:38px;padding:.42rem .62rem}.pricing-page-module__XIdHSa__overviewActions,.pricing-page-module__XIdHSa__bottomCtaActions{width:100%}.pricing-page-module__XIdHSa__inlineAction,.pricing-page-module__XIdHSa__inlineActionSecondary,.pricing-page-module__XIdHSa__bottomActionButton{flex:1 1 0}.pricing-page-module__XIdHSa__bottomActionButton{border-radius:13px;min-height:42px;padding:.7rem .95rem;font-size:.86rem}.pricing-page-module__XIdHSa__sectionCard{padding:1.1rem}.pricing-page-module__XIdHSa__tableWrap{padding:.15rem .95rem}.pricing-page-module__XIdHSa__pricingTable thead{display:none}.pricing-page-module__XIdHSa__pricingTable,.pricing-page-module__XIdHSa__pricingTable tbody,.pricing-page-module__XIdHSa__pricingTable tr,.pricing-page-module__XIdHSa__pricingTable th,.pricing-page-module__XIdHSa__pricingTable td{width:100%;display:block}.pricing-page-module__XIdHSa__pricingTable tbody tr{border-top:1px solid #0f274414;padding:1rem 0}.pricing-page-module__XIdHSa__pricingTable tbody tr:first-child{border-top:none;padding-top:.55rem}.pricing-page-module__XIdHSa__pricingTable tbody tr:nth-child(2n){background:0 0}.pricing-page-module__XIdHSa__pricingTable tbody th,.pricing-page-module__XIdHSa__pricingTable tbody td{border:none;padding:0}.pricing-page-module__XIdHSa__serviceCell{width:100%;padding-bottom:.8rem}.pricing-page-module__XIdHSa__pricingTable tbody td{text-align:left;white-space:normal;justify-content:space-between;align-items:flex-start;gap:1rem;padding:.45rem 0;display:flex}.pricing-page-module__XIdHSa__pricingTable tbody td:before{content:attr(data-label);color:var(--gray-400);letter-spacing:.08em;text-transform:uppercase;font-size:.72rem;font-weight:700}}@media (max-width:560px){.pricing-page-module__XIdHSa__highlightList{grid-template-columns:1fr}.pricing-page-module__XIdHSa__heroActions,.pricing-page-module__XIdHSa__bottomCtaActions{flex-direction:column;align-items:stretch}.pricing-page-module__XIdHSa__bottomCtaActions{gap:.6rem}}
